Abstract
Recent work on the nature of the Earth's lateral heterogeneities yields two conclusions with implications for mantle dynamics: seismic velocity differences between continents and oceans extend to depths exceeding 400 km, and strong lateral velocity gradients at depths greater than 800 km characterise the mantle beneath many subduction zones. These results suggest that more than just the crust and upper mantle are involved in whatever form of convection is responsible for plate motions.
